// LockT and TryLockT are the preferred construct to lock/tryLock/unlock
// simple and recursive mutexes. You typically allocate them on the
// stack to hold a lock on a mutex.
-// LockT and TryLockT are not recursive: you cannot acquire several times
+// LockT and TryLockT are not recursive: you cannot acquire several times
// in a row a lock with the same Lock or TryLock object.
